Section 46.063 Callaway.
Callaway.
46.063. Beginning at a point in the middle of the main channel of the Missouri River, where a prolongation south of the range line between ranges six and seven, west, would intersect the same; thence north with said range line to the northeast corner of township forty-nine, range seven, west; thence west with the township line between townships forty-nine and fifty to the main fork of Cedar Creek; thence down said creek, in the middle of the main channel thereof, to its southern intersection with the range line between ranges eleven and twelve; thence south with said range line to the middle of the main channel of the Missouri River; thence down said river, in the middle of the main channel thereof, to the place of beginning.
(RSMo 1939 13556)Prior revisions: 1929 11897; 1919 9299; 1909 3516
